SXEmacs, based on the XEmacs 21.4 code base, supports up to 26 mouse
buttons. Steve Youngs’ patches to implement this are here:
http://www.sxemacs.org/list-archives/html/sxemacs-patches/2005-08/msg00002.html
http://www.sxemacs.org/list-archives/html/sxemacs-patches/2005-08/msg00000.html
and should apply relatively easily to XEmacs trunk, once you’ve worked
around the change in C style.
